The Wiert Corner – irregular stream of stuff

Jeroen W. Pluimers on .NET, C#, Delphi, databases, and personal interests

  • My badges

  • Twitter Updates

  • My Flickr Stream

  • Pages

  • All categories

  • Enter your email address to subscribe to this blog and receive notifications of new posts by email.

    Join 1,862 other subscribers

Archive for October, 2011

#lopentegenkanker een success, grote opkomst, goede organisatie

Posted by jpluimers on 2011/10/10

Afgelopen zondag in de gemeente Teylingen aan Lopen Tegen Kanker meegedaan. Voor mij de eerste keer sinds een flinke tijd dat ik een 10km liep (66 minuten, niet een geweldige tijd, mar wel uitgelopen). Loopmaatje Otto van Dijk liep hem in 48 minuten (en dat met een verkoudheid!) en vrouw Nicolette liep de 5km in 36 minuten (herstellend van een hielspoor viel haar dat reuze mee). Otto – nr 123 – en ik – n3 65 – hebben zelfs de Teyding gehaald!

Twee kleine kritiekpuntjes (hebben we dat vast gehad <g>):

  1. Het afhalen van de startnummers van de voorinschrijvingen was veel te druk, waardoor beide starttijden een kwartier uitgesteld werden. Volgend jaar per afstand van de voorinschrijving 2 loketten openen, en dan loopt dat ook gesmeerd.
  2. De route op de site was niet echt heel duidelijk (tijdens het lopen wel), onderstaand de route voor de 5km en 10km die gelopen is.

Voor de rest niets dan lof over de organisatie: dit was de eerste keer dat Lopen Tegen Kanker werd georganiseerd, en het liep gesmeerd:

  1. Overal vrijwilligers die je konden helpen
  2. Goed aangegeven route
  3. Ruim voldoende verkeersregelaars
  4. Meerdere waterpunten tijdens de 10km route
  5. Heerlijke loopomstandigheden (15 graden en een klein beetje miezerregen: perfect!)
  6. Mooie omgeving (voor ik richtin Amsterdam verhuisde heb ik 25 jaar in Sassenheim gewoond, en was een beetje vergeten dat de omgeving zo mooi eigenlijk is)
  7. Een fantastische start/finish (met leuke omroeper, fijne muziekband, genoeg water, en genoeg ruimte)

Tijdens het finishen van de 10km was ook de geZZinsloop in volle gang; wat een geweldige combinatie van ouders met kinderen was dat!

Deze loop heb ik opgedragen aan loopmaatje Conny (die vrijdag een borstbesparende operatie onderging, iets dat – dankzij research – tegenwoordig met een dagopname mogelijk is!) en vrouw Nicolette (die 10 jaar geleden een erfelijke vorm van kanker kreeg, maar na een operatie – half pond bilspier weg – en bestraling toch mooi de 5 km gelopen heeft).

Ik kijk nu al uit naar volgend jaar!

Volg tegen die tijd ook weer de Twitter hash #lopentegenkanker (dit jaar staan daar een boel leuke tweets).

–jeroen

Route 5 km: Start 11:15 uur Route 10 km: Start 11:00 uur
Warmond

  1. Start Groot Leerust
  2. Dorpsstraat
  3. Gemeentehaven
  4. Rondje Koudenhoorn buitenzijde
    (met de klok mee)
  5. Gemeentehaven
  6. Dorpsstraat
  7. Burgemeester Nederburghlaan
  8. Van Beverningkstraat
  9. Warmundstraat
  10. Doctor Ammanstraat
  11. Julianastraat
  12. Margrietstraat
  13. Beatrixlaan
  14. Burgemeester Ketelaarstraat
  15. Finish Groot Leerust
Warmond

  1. Start Groot Leerust
  2. Dorpsstraat
  3. Bisschoplaan
  4. Monseigneur Aengenentlaan
  5. Oude Dam
  6. Spoorpad

Sassenheim

  1. Klinkenberg
  2. Rijksstraatweg
  3. Edisonstraat

Voorhout

  1. Oosthoutlaan
  2. Azaleahof
  3. Korenbloemstraat
  4. Distelweg
  5. Oosthoutplein
  6. Anijsweg
  7. Kruidenschans
  8. Peperzoom
  9. Peperstraat
  10. Rozemarijnhof
  11. Snoeklaan
  12. Voornhof
  13. Eikenhorstlaan
  14. Van de Berch van Heemstedeweg

Sassenheim

  1. Zandslootkade
  2. Hoofdstraat
  3. Zuilhofstraat
  4. Van Alkemadelaan
  5. Kwekersweg
  6. Wasbeekerlaan
  7. Jagtlustkade
  8. Warmonderweg

Warmond

  1. Wasbeeklaan vervangen door Warmonderweg
  2. Oosteinde
  3. Herenweg
  4. Beatrixlaan
  5. Burgemeester Ketelaarstraat
  6. Finish Groot Leerust

Posted in About, Personal | Leave a Comment »

Writing an audio CD as ISO image is a no-no: the closest you get is a .CUE file that links to either WAV files or a BIN/IMG image

Posted by jpluimers on 2011/10/10

Recently I had to create an Audio CD image to record it on a bunch of recordables to do some comparisons.

One of the things I learned is that you cannot create a CD ISO image file from a bunch of 44.1 Khz PCM encoded stereo audio WAV files.

The reason is that ISO images contain a file system, whereas audio CDs don’t (and contain their index in the sub-track data).

Since most CD software do not support the DDP format, the easiest way to go is .CUE/.BIN way:

  1. Create a .CUE file that refers to the .WAV files (for instance by using the ImgBurn  Tools -> Create CUE file option)
  2. Mount that .CUE file as a virtual audio CD using a virtual CD mounting tool like DAEMON tools
  3. Capture that .CUE/.BIN combo (some software uses .IMG instead of .BIN)
  4. Burn the .CUE/.BIN combo to physical CDs

Probably there are shorter steps (by shortcutting the mounting), but this worked fine for me.

–jeroen

Read the rest of this entry »

Posted in Power User | 1 Comment »

#lopentegenkanker wie moedigt ons zondag aan of rent mee in #warmond #sassenheim #voorhout in de gemeente #teylingen?

Posted by jpluimers on 2011/10/08

Nicolette, ik en nog ruim 400 andere mensen gaan zondagochtend Lopen Tegen Kanker.

Er zijn 4 routes: 1 wandelroute, 2 hardlooproutes en 1geZZinsloop.

Inschrijfgeld is EUR 10 per persoon voor de wandel/hardlooproutes. De geZZinsloop is een sponsorloop.

Nicolette doet de 5 km (plaatje links): een pittoreske route door Warmond en het Koudenhoorn eiland aan het Joppe.

Ik doe de 10 km: een mooie route die ook de dorpskernen van Sassenheim en Voorhout aan doet.

Er lopen vele andere mee, waaronder Otto van Dijk, Chantal Peeters en nog ruim 400 anderen.

Nicolette en ik lopen deze keer voor een loopmaatje die afgelopen vrijdag een borstbesparende operatie onderging.
Nicolette loopt uiteraard ook voor haarzelf: ze is al ruim 10 jaar vrij van kanker en ondanks het gemis van een deel van haar bilspier loopt ze die 5 km toch maar mooi mee!

Meer deelnemers en supporters langs de kant zijn van harte welkom: ik heb (vanwege de zorg rondom het duikincident in de Kreidensee) al ruim een week niet gelopen, en zaterdagavond een mooi concert (de Adest Night of Music): de 10 km wordt een uitdaging, maar met een gepast tempo en genoeg supporters gaat het gewoon lukken.

Straatnamen van de routes staan hieronder.
Let op: Op de site van Lopen Tegen Kanker is het onduidelijk welke richting de routes nemen, dus ze kunnen ook in omgekeerde volgorde zijn!

–jeroen

Route 5 km: Start 11:15 uur Route 10 km: Start 11:00 uur
Warmond

  1. Start Groot Leerust
  2. Burgemeester Ketelaarstraat
  3. Beatrixlaan
  4. Margrietstraat
  5. Julianastraat
  6. Doctor Ammanstraat
  7. Warmundstraat
  8. Van Beverningkstraat
  9. Burgemeester Nederburghlaan
  10. Dorpsstraat
  11. Gemeentehaven
  12. Rondje Koudenhoorn buitenzijde
    (met of tegen de klok in?)
  13. Gemeentehaven
  14. Dorpsstraat
  15. Finish Groot Leerust
Warmond

  1. Start Groot Leerust
  2. Burgemeester Ketelaarstraat
  3. Beatrixlaan
  4. Herenweg
  5. Oosteinde
  6. Wasbeeklaan

Sassenheim

  1. Wasbeekerlaan
  2. Kwekersweg
  3. Van Alkemadelaan
  4. Zuilhofstraat
  5. Hoofdstraat
  6. Zandslootkade

Voorhout

  1. Van de Berch van Heemstedeweg
  2. Eikenhorstlaan
  3. Voornhof
  4. Snoeklaan
  5. Rozemarijnhof
  6. Peperstraat
  7. Peperzoom
  8. Kruidenschans
  9. Anijsweg
  10. Oosthoutplein
  11. Distelweg
  12. Korenbloemstraat
  13. Azaleahof
  14. Oosthoutlaan

Sassenheim

  1. Edisonstraat
  2. Rijksstraatweg
  3. Klinkenberg

Warmond

  1. Spoorpad
  2. Oude Dam
  3. Monseigneur Aengenentlaan
  4. Bisschoplaan
  5. Dorpsstraat
  6. Finish Groot Leerust

Posted in About, Personal | 1 Comment »

Alles op het gebied van TV series: Bierdopje.com en eztv.it

Posted by jpluimers on 2011/10/08

Altijd al gezegd: overal is een site voor. En dus ook over TV series.

In dit geval dus Bierdopje.com. Samen met eztv.it heel erg handig als je inzicht wilt krijgen in welke series nu wanneer wel (of niet: als er bijvoorbeeld een sportuitzending is, of als ze ineens een film of special uitzenden) worden uitgezonden.

Er zijn zelfs mensen die de ondertitels intikken :)

–jeroen

via: Bierdopje.com | Frontpage.

Posted in LifeHacker, Power User | 2 Comments »

Infineon SLE 66 CL PE chip achter de nieuwe “veiliger” OV Chipkaart is reeds gehacked – Reactie | Pro | Tweakers.net

Posted by jpluimers on 2011/10/07

Security by obscurity maakt het alleen maar lastiger, maar uiteindelijk gaat de nieuwe veiliger OV Chipkaart ook gehacked worden, zeker nu de achterliggende Infineon SLE 66 CL PE chip gehacked is.

–jeroen

via: Reactie | Pro | Tweakers.net.

Posted in LifeHacker, Power User | Leave a Comment »

#tzdb Civil Suit Filed, Involving the Time Zone Database: Arthur David Olson and Paul Eggert need help (via Slashdot)

Posted by jpluimers on 2011/10/07

The tzdb (Timezone Database) is an important database of current and historical timezone information.

Yesterday, it became clear that a civil suit was filed on September 30, 2011 by Astrolabe over parts of the historic data in the tzdb.

As a reasult, the tzdb download and mailing list has been shut down (already archived at the WayBack machine).

This might be speculative, but I find the coincidence with the plans of the IETF taking over the maintenance of the tzdb, as well as the sudden number of edits on the Wikipeda tzdb page before the suit was filed stunning (thanks Ghostworks for pointing me to the latter).

A lot of software depends on the tzdb (Unix, Linux, Mac, Windows, IBM, you name it). As soon as you have used a timezone like “Europe/Amsterdam”, you have likely used the tzdb in one form or the other.

Arthur David Olson and Paul Eggert most likekely need help, lets hope one of the big companies helps them.

–jeroen

PS: When I started writing this blog post, the tz database Wikipedia page didn’t mention the law suit, now it does. But given the frequent changes mentioned above, I’m not sure which information on that page is correct or incorrect.

via: Civil Suit Filed, Involving the Time Zone Database – Slashdot.

Posted in Development, Power User, Software Development | 3 Comments »

Why can’t I move the Program Files directory via the unattend file? – via: The Old New Thing – Site Home – MSDN Blogs

Posted by jpluimers on 2011/10/07

You cannot move the C:\Program Files directory to another volume without installing Windows on that volume.

A small abstract from the explanation by Raymond Chen: The symbiotic relation between C:\Windows\WinSxS and C:\Program Files through NTFS hard links prevents you to move C:\Program Files (nor WinSxS) to a different disk volume. Both directories need to be on the same volume because of the NTFS hard link limitation.

NTFS hardlinks do save a ton of diskspace, even though WinSxS will keep growing over time, which means you need to do some careful disk volume planning, especially on SSD drives.

–jeroen

via: Why can’t I move the Program Files directory via the unattend file? – The Old New Thing – Site Home – MSDN Blogs.

Posted in Microsoft Surface on Windows 7, Power User, Windows, Windows 7, Windows 8, Windows Server 2000, Windows Server 2003, Windows Server 2003 R2, Windows Server 2008, Windows Server 2008 R2, Windows Vista, Windows XP | Leave a Comment »

Registry Search-Replace tools – correcting the havoc after a data migration

Posted by jpluimers on 2011/10/07

A while ago, I found myself in the situation where at a corporate client the user profiles had moved on the LAN. Very understandable: it was one of the migrations towards DFS. They notified this in advance, so I made backups of everything (home drive and user profile) just to make sure.

The move indeed caused all sorts of havoc, because the data was moved, but the registry was only slightly modified.

Some of the errors I got were like these:

[Internet Explorer - Search Provider Default]
A program on your computer has corrupted your default search provider setting for Internet Explorer.

Internet Explorer has reset this setting to your original search provider, Live Search (search.live.com).

Internet Explorer will now open Search Settings, where you can change this setting or install more search providers.
[OK]

and

[Desktop]
\\old-server\old-share\user-id\Desktop refers to a location that is unavailable. It could be on a hard drive on this computer, or on a network. Check to make sure that the disk is properly inserted, or that you are connected to the Internet or your network, and then try again. If it still cannot be located, the information might have been moved to a different location.
[OK]

Below some of the ramblings on what I did to get everything working again, including registry searches when you are not allowed to run RegEdit, searching through text, and the places in the registry that had to change. Read the rest of this entry »

Posted in .NET, C#, Delphi, Development, Encoding, Power User, Software Development, Unicode | Leave a Comment »

When you are bitten by normally having the luxury of a current development environment

Posted by jpluimers on 2011/10/06

Sometimes you are at clients that don’t fully appreciate the luxury of keeping their development environment current.

This case a client still using Delphi 2006, where I promptly ran into a compiler error that was solved 5 years ago: a “F2084 Internal Error: C11919” at the end of the method.

begin
  if RMQResult.Create(CompCode, Reason).IsOK then
//...
end; // [Pascal Fatal Error] MQObjects.pas(668): F2084 Internal Error: C11919

The cause is that the compiler barfs at calling a method on a freshly created record.
The function result is an intermediate, which is not handled correctly (fixed in Delphi 2007).

This is not only for record intermediates: reusing an intermediate like the result of Pred() will crash the compiler in Delphi 2006.

The workaround is introducing a real variable.
This works:

var
  MQResult: RMQResult;
begin
  MQResult := RMQResult.Create(CompCode, Reason);
  if MQResult.IsOK then
//...
end; // compiles fine

–jeroen

Posted in Delphi, Development, F2084, Software Development | 4 Comments »

In memoriam – Duikers Fred Snijders en Nico Laan (via: Onderwatersport Bond | Duiken in Nederland | Duikopleiding | Duikinstructeur | Duikbrevetten)

Posted by jpluimers on 2011/10/05

Ik kom hier in een later stadium op terug omdat het nu te druk is met regelen van van alles en nog wat bij de rouwverwerking voor met name mijn broer Martijn, die – ondanks een IQ van 50 – natuurlijk niet dom is.

Voor mijn broer Martijn is dit een groot verlies, niet zo groot als dat van onze vader in 2004, maar toch: met name Fred Snijders was een belangrijk persoon, en ook Nico Laan (die van nature wat meer op de achtergrond verbleef) heeft mijn broer zekerheid geboden bij het duiken.

Hier alvast een quote van http://www.onderwatersport.org/:

In memoriam

Afgelopen weekend bereikte ons het trieste bericht dat NOB-leden Fred Snijders (59 jaar) en Nico Laan (54 jaar) om het leven zijn gekomen bij een duikongeval in de Noord-Duitse Kreidesee. Beide mannen maakten deel uit van een groep van zes ervaren Nederlandse duikers. De groep raakte zaterdag door nog onbekende oorzaak in de problemen. Nadat vier van hen boven wisten te komen, bleken Fred Snijders en Nico Laan vermist. Zondagmiddag, kort na het begin van een tweede zoektocht, werden hun lichamen gevonden en geborgen.

Fred Snijders was binnen de NOB een bekend en zeer gewaardeerd persoon. Velen zullen Fred herinneren als instructeur, instructeur-trainer of IAHD Pro Trainer. Ook was hij vanaf 2002 lid van de ‘mobiele brigade’, tegenwoordig NOB-inschalingscommissie. Hij was intensief betrokken bij de inschaling van vele sportduikinstructeurs, brandweerduikinstructeurs en defensieduikinstructeurs. Daarnaast richtte Fred in 2005 de Stichting Gehandicaptenduiksport West-Friesland ‘Fun Diving’ op en stond hij aan de basis van projecten als ‘Duiken voor iedereen’ in Grootebroek, ‘7-sprong’ in Lisse en ‘De Bonte Drie’ te Mussel. Fred stond bekend om zijn grote, enthousiaste en gedreven inzet voor duikers met een beperking. Nico Laan, 3*-duiker en lid van Fun Diving, was vooral op lokaal niveau actief en bekend.

Het bestuur en de bureaumedewerkers van de Nederlandse Onderwatersport Bond wensen de nabestaanden van Fred en Nico veel sterkte met het dragen van dit grote verlies.

–jeroen

via Onderwatersport Bond | Duiken in Nederland | Duikopleiding | Duikinstructeur | Duikbrevetten.

Posted in About, Personal | 1 Comment »